NVDL, the GraniteShares 2x Long NVDA Daily ETF, trades at $30.7, down 7.05% in the last 24 hours, reflecting high volatility tied to its leveraged exposure to NVIDIA. Technical indicators show a bullish trend with moving averages supporting upward momentum, while oscillators remain neutral. Recent stock splits on June 25 and 26, 2026, adjusted the share structure, but key financial ratios like P/E and P/S are unavailable, limiting fundamental clarity. The ETF's performance is directly driven by daily NVIDIA price movements, amplified by its 2x leverage.
The outlook for NVDL hinges on NVIDIA's AI-driven growth, offering potential for high returns but with significant risk due to leverage compounding losses during downturns. Investors face volatility risks, as seen in a 12% single-day drop on June 5, 2026, and must monitor NVIDIA's earnings and broader semiconductor trends. Caution is advised given the lack of traditional fundamentals and the ETF's reset mechanism, which can erode value over time in volatile markets.

Read more on BC →NVDL is a leveraged ETF that seeks daily investment results corresponding to 200% (2x) of the daily performance of NVIDIA Corporation (NVDA) stock. It is designed as a tactical trading tool for investors with a strong bullish (long) view on NVDA. Due to the effects of compounding and leverage, the ETF is intended to be held for a single day and is not suitable for long-term investment, as its performance over longer periods may significantly deviate from two times the performance of the NVDA stock.
